The Stainless Gunny is the latest addition to Bark River Knife and Tool's Search & Rescue Series. It joins the Larger Bravo-II and Bravo-1 in this series.
The Gunny is a smaller version of the Bravo-1 that Bark River Developed for the Force Recon Units of the U.S. Marine Corp. This scaled down version is designed to be as rugged and as useful but in a smaller--easier to carry package. The knife easily makes the Crossover from Military use to civilian use and is an excellent choice for a smaller all around hiking & camping knife.
The Gunny Handle Scales are Contoured in the same style as the larger Bravo-1 and 2.

Specs:
Overall Length: 8.4 Inches
Blade Length: 3.775 Inches
Blade Steel: 19c27 @ 58rc
Blade thickness: .154 Inch
Weight: 5.625 Ounces
